Zimbabwe's first lady Grace Mugabe will make her first court appearance in South Africa today.

Police minister Fikile Mbalula has confirmed to JacarandaFM News that Mugabe is set to appear in the Wynberg Magistrate's Court after she allegedly assaulted a Johannesburg woman.



It is alleged the Zimbabwean first lady attacked the woman at a Sandton hotel on Sunday night.



The 20-year-old is believed to have sustained injuries to her face. 



Pictures on social media appear to show the 20-year-old with a bleeding wound. 



The Department of International Relations has blatantly refused to confirm whether Mugabe is in South Africa with her diplomatic passport.



The department has reportedly said Mugabe's trip was "a private visit so government cannot get involved if an alleged crime is committed."



Gauteng community safety MEC Sizakele Nkosi-Malobane has told JacarandaFM News that the case should be pursued through the courts.



"We hope justice will be done and that it will send a strong message to all leaders who think they can abuse their power and assault innocent people in our country," she said.
